Skip to content

Escape HTML entities in commit messages

Douwe Maan requested to merge dm-escape-commit-message into master

Fixes https://gitlab.com/gitlab-org/gitlab-ce/issues/42833

Effectively reverses https://gitlab.com/gitlab-org/gitlab-ce/merge_requests/6937, but doesn't reintroduce the bug that was meant to fix. See https://gitlab.com/gitlab-org/gitlab-ce/issues/42833#note_58460771 for more background.

For a commit with commit message & &:

Before:

Screen_Shot_2018-02-15_at_12.09.10

Screen_Shot_2018-02-15_at_12.09.14

After:

Screen_Shot_2018-02-15_at_12.08.52

Screen_Shot_2018-02-15_at_12.08.47

Merge request reports